battery terminals Help

Hi
took the battery off my old avon searider last winter just gone to put it back on, but not sure which is the correct way both battery wires are Black!! one has a clamp with an N on it but not convinced !! is there an easy way to double check which is neutral & live the motor is merc 50 approx 1998

Yep. Put a multimeter between the lead and the casing. When you get continuity, thats the negative.
